Binaural switch control position
Options
IW7DMH, Enzo
Member ✭✭
I don't know if it is already asked, but I would like to know why the "binaural" button is in the Radio Setup menu and not in one of the GUI control panels.
I am finding the binaural feature very effective, just in these days with low level signals coming from South America, but I am finding it a bit difficult switching on and off.
Do you provide to move it in a more accessible place? (I would suggest the RX panel next to the pan control - reducing just a bit the slider control)

Enzo,
FYI, FRStack by AA3RK will allow you to set up a hotkey ( keyboard short cut) to toggle Binual on/off, as well as map other functions to hotkeys..
AL, K0VM
0 -
Binaural listening is a global radio feature and not panadapter or slice specific. This is why it is in the global feature setup0
